Granite Fold's migration to the Cinderbox hermetic build system removes all implicit host dependencies. Every toolchain, library, and credential is now declared in the build manifest, which makes provenance auditable end to end. Network fetches are disabled inside the sandbox; the only permitted remote call is to the sealed artifact cache, authenticated per build. Deploy hosts therefore need the cache credential present before invoking Cinderbox. Add it to the host env file directly after this line.

vault entry, yahif-yajep: COURIER_KEY29=b802bdf8034096b65a51c6ba5abe2

**Onboarding: Meetmesh calendar sync.** New hires often see duplicate events during their first week because Meetmesh mirrors two upstream calendars and resolves conflicts by last-write-wins. If you spot duplicates, run the dedupe job rather than deleting events by hand — manual deletes propagate back upstream. The dedupe job reads your local env file, and it needs the sync credential added on the line directly below.

sealed setting: VAULT_KEY20=c8ea1e419912889df6b4

Welcome to the Marquevelle Stagecraft team. The seat-map renderer, codenamed Velvetine, draws the auditorium layout for the Orpheline Theatre from our internal SeatGrid service. Before running it locally, install the render toolkit, then point your config at the staging SeatGrid endpoint — never production, since holds placed there are real. Verify that the balcony tiers render with correct row offsets before touching pricing overlays. To authenticate against SeatGrid staging, use the key below.

gateway credential: kto3_qfe

Changed defaults in Splitfork, our assignment service. Bucketing now uses sticky hashing per account instead of per session, and the holdout slice grew from 2% to 5%. Callers relying on session-level reassignment must opt in explicitly. Review the diff against the new baseline; the updated default configuration is listed below.

config for tagep-kajof:
[casir]
port = 6379
region = south-1
host = casir.paliqdyn.example
team = tamax
timeout_ms = 250
retries = 2